#cd4e20 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cd4e20 is composed of 80.4% red, 30.6% green and 12.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 62% magenta, 84.4%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 16 degrees, a saturation of 73% and a lightness of 46.5%. #cd4e20 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9c40 with #9b0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#cd4e20 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#cd4e20 has RGB values of R:205, G:78, B:32 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.62, Y:0.84,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 13454880.
